mixture control solenoid — (M/C) [1] A device, installed in carburetor, which regulates the air/fuel ratio by oscillating the metering rods. [2] A computer controlled device in a feedback carburetor that alters the mixture adjustment by moving the carburetor s metering rod … Dictionary of automotive terms
main metering circuit — The cruising circuit or the high speed circuit. It supplies the correct air/fuel mixture to the engine during cruising and high speed conditions. Also called main metering system … Dictionary of automotive terms
